Do you seek the Lord’s favor by making promises of what you will do for Him if only He will grant your desire? The Israelites continuously found themselves in impossible situations because of their lack of follow-through. Every time they were greatly oppressed they would cry out to the Lord for help, usually promising to do anything He asked of them if only He would save them. But the fulfillment of their promise was usually short-lived; just long enough for them to become comfortable again. 

When the Ammonites came to take back their land Israel cried out once more. This time Father rebuked them saying: “I saved you from the Egyptians, the Emorim, the people of ‘Amon, and the P’lishtim, didn’t I? Likewise, when the people of Tzidon, ‘Amalek and Ma’on oppressed you, you cried out to me; and I rescued you from their power. Yet you abandoned me and served other gods; therefore I will not rescue you anymore. Go and cry to the gods you chose; let them rescue you when you’re in trouble!” (Judges 10:11-14) Hearing those words they got rid of their foreign gods, again, and served the Lord.

They sought out a warrior brave enough to go into battle and promised to make him their leader. (Judges 10:18) Jephthah agreed and seeking the Lord’s victory, promised to sacrifice as a burnt offering whatever first came out of his house when he returned from victory. The Lord honored his request but it cost Jephthah dearly; his only daughter was to be his offering.

Do you try to bribe God into action on your behalf? There is only one thing He wants from you–loyalty. Do you seek Father’s favor for the coming year? Resolve to put him first by spending time each day in his presence.
